What is a Landing Page?
A landing page is a standalone web page designed specifically for a marketing or advertising campaign. Its primary goal is to direct visitors towards taking a particular action, such as signing up for a newsletter or making a purchase.
Key Elements of an Effective Landing Page
While various designs exist, certain elements are commonly found in successful landing pages:
- Compelling Headline: Captures attention and clearly states the offer.
- Engaging Visuals: High-quality images or videos that illustrate the offer.
- Concise Copy: Clear and persuasive text highlighting the benefits of the offer.
- Strong Call-to-Action (CTA): An obvious button prompting visitors to take action.
- Trust Signals: Testimonials, reviews, or security badges that build confidence.
Top Examples of Landing Pages
1. Airbnb
Airbnb's landing page is designed to quickly engage users. They use attractive images, a straightforward search option for accommodations, and a clear CTA that invites users to 'Start your search.' This direct approach helps increase conversions.
2. Dropbox
Dropbox effectively uses minimalistic design and a strong headline to convey its value proposition. The clear CTA and benefits list encourage users to sign up for their service without distractions.
3. HubSpot
HubSpot's landing page excels at lead generation. With a compelling ebook offer, they utilize testimonials to enhance credibility and a simple form that emphasizes ease of use.
4. Shopify
Shopify’s landing page focuses on providing a clear path to sign up for their service, showcasing key benefits and a simple, engaging format that encourages users to get started.
5. Basecamp
Basecamp employs a striking layout, with a prominent CTA and persuasive copy. They also offer social proof through user testimonials and showcase a clear value for new users looking to streamline project management.
Lessons Learned from Successful Landing Pages
Examining these successful examples teaches several critical lessons:
- Make your value proposition clear and concise.
- Use captivating visuals to grab attention.
- Include an explicit and easy-to-find CTA.
- Leverage social proof to build trust with your audience.
